Output 3bfbc45ae3de338779b66149c809c60d89ea73874cd070bc0549a01786df4d86:0

value
15009591
script pubkey
OP_0 OP_PUSHBYTES_20 54fa595acd36fc63f98e1eeb50e80408c61a067f
address
bc1q2na9jkkdxm7x87vwrm44p6qyprrp5pnlduc5vm
transaction
3bfbc45ae3de338779b66149c809c60d89ea73874cd070bc0549a01786df4d86
confirmations
79165
spent
true